From 926acb910e2dd3c20b782f3a34b4bc60147e5257 Mon Sep 17 00:00:00 2001 From: Bjarke Berg Date: Thu, 4 Jul 2019 10:35:48 +0200 Subject: [PATCH] Forces the initial migration state of V7 sites that are allowed to be migrated into v7.14 state. --- src/Umbraco.Core/Migrations/Upgrade/UmbracoPlan.cs |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/src/Umbraco.Core/Migrations/Upgrade/UmbracoPlan.cs b/src/Umbraco.Core/Migrations/Upgrade/UmbracoPlan.cs index 834eade986..6c8099ffb0 100644 --- a/src/Umbraco.Core/Migrations/Upgrade/UmbracoPlan.cs +++ b/src/Umbraco.Core/Migrations/Upgrade/UmbracoPlan.cs @@ -74,6 +74,10 @@ namespace Umbraco.Core.Migrations.Upgrade throw new InvalidOperationException($"Version {currentVersion} cannot be migrated to {UmbracoVersion.SemanticVersion}." + $" Please upgrade first to at least {minVersion}."); + // Force newer versions of 7, into 7.14, when migrating + if (currentVersion.Major == 7) + return GetInitState(minVersion); + // initial state is eg "{init-7.14.0}" return GetInitState(currentVersion); }